Partnership Will Provide Avolon’s Customers With Access to Broad Range of CFM LEAP Services StandardAero, Inc. (NYSE:SARO), a leading independent pure-play provider of aerospace engine aftermarket services including engine maintenance, repair and overhaul (MRO) and engine component repair, has signed a LeaseTEAM agreement with global leasing company Avolon which will provide the lessor’s customers with access to a broad range of CFM International LEAP-1A and LEAP-1B engine services. Avolon’s fleet includes approximately 150 delivered Airbus A320neo (LEAP-1A) and 54 Boeing 737 MAX (LEAP-1B) new generation narrowbody aircraft. This press release features multimedia. Flagship Airline of the Dominican Republic Becomes StandardAero’s Latest LATAM Customer StandardAero, Inc. (NYSE:SARO), a leading independent pure-play provider of aerospace engine aftermarket services including engine maintenance, repair and overhaul (MRO) and engine component repair, has signed an agreement with Arajet, the flagship airline of the Dominican Republic, to provide MRO services for the CFM International LEAP-1B engine. The LEAP-1B powers Arajet’s growing fleet of new generation Boeing 737 MAX 8 narrowbody aircraft. Spitale Succeeds Anthony Brancato, Who is Retiring After 40 Years in Aviation StandardAero (NYSE:SARO), a leading independent pure-play provider of aerospace engine aftermarket services, including engine maintenance, repair and overhaul (MRO) and engine component repair, today announced Giovanni Spitale as President of its Business Aviation segment effective immediately. Spitale will replace Anthony (Tony) Brancato III, who is retiring after nearly a decade in leadership positions with StandardAero and more than four decades in aviation. NEW YORK, Jan. 16,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- StandardAero Inc. (NYSE:SARO) will replace Frontier Communications Parent Inc. (NASD: FYBR) in the S&P MidCap 400 effective prior to the opening of trading on Thursday, January 22. S&P 500 & S&P 100 constituent Verizon Communications Inc. (NYSE:VZ) is acquiring Frontier Communications Parent in a deal expected to close soon pending final conditions. StandardAero (NYSE:SARO), a leading independent pure-play provider of aerospace engine aftermarket services including engine maintenance, repair and overhaul (MRO) and engine component repair, today announced it has acquired Unified Turbines, LLC (Unified Turbines) in an all-cash transaction. Unified Turbines represents StandardAero's 14th acquisition since 2015 and eighth acquisition in its Component Repair Services (CRS) segment. Founded in 1997 and operating out of its facility in Milton, VT, Unified Turbines is an FAA Repair Station.
